Day 1
- VIP transfer from the airport to the hospital.
- Private room accommodation provided.
- Consultation with a hematologist for initial assessment.
Day 2 to 3
- Consultation with a cardiologist and pulmonologist.
- Diagnostic tests including blood tests, imaging studies.
- Additional procedures like bone marrow biopsy if needed.
Day 4
- Preparation for transplantation including conditioning regimen.
- Meeting with anesthesiologist for preoperative assessment.
Day 5
- Allogenic bone marrow transplantation from a related donor.
- Procedure lasts about 1-2 hours under general anesthesia.
Day 6 to Week 2
- Post-operation monitoring in the clinic.
- Regular check-ups and medication adjustments.
Week 3 to 8
- Outpatient follow-up and gradual recovery.
- Physical therapy as part of rehabilitation.
Week 8 onwards
- Return to work, light physical activities.
- Full recovery and normal activities after 12 weeks.
Please note that this schedule may vary depending on individual patient conditions and recovery progress.
